Be prepared to stop fire damage

Info

There are many options for car fire extinguishers, but this is the one that I use. It is $27 on Amazon. That's pretty cheap for something that could prevent or minimize A LOT of damage. This one fits very securely in the driver's door. It uses Sodium Bicarbonate (baking soda). It is effective against oil, gas, and electrical fires. However, the powder settle with time and vibration, so every time you change you engine oil, you should pull it out, turn it over, and loosen the powder.
